Gamespot informs us a demo is to be released today for Lord of the Rings: Battle for Middle Earth II.
An exact time has not been announced, but the demo will at least be showing off the single player and multiplayer aspects of the game. The War of the North missions shall be accompanied with a tutorial to make console gamers familiar with the unique control scheme devised for playing RTS on their trusty Xbox 360. In single player you will be an Evil leader attacking an Elven Stronghold, and in multiplayer you play either an Elven or Goblin army fighting to the death on Xbox Live.

The Xbox 360 Marketplace is officially shutting down in three days, which means dozens of exclusive, digital-only 360 games will no longer be available to purchase anywhere else once it does.
